THE NECESSITY OF FOREIGN LANGUAGE LINGUISTIC COMPETENCE IN THE STATE CIVIL SERVICE OF THE RUSSIAN FEDERATION

 
 
 

Abstract


Subject. Foreign language (linguistic) competence in the Civil Service of the Russian Federation Topic. Problems of linguistic competence in the Civil Service of the Russian Federation Goals. Analysis of normative acts and reference sources that define aspects of linguistic competence in the civil service of the Russian Federation. Identification of the practical need for foreign language (linguistic) competence in the civil service of the Russian Federation. Methodology. The method of comparative analysis of statistical data, assessment of the regulatory framework in the field of foreign language (linguistic) competence. Results. In the process of analyses of the foreign language linguistic competence of the civil servants development, practical and reputational incentives that contribute to an increase of the level of linguistic (foreign language) competence of the civil servants were identified. As a solution, it was proposed to develop a specialized advanced training course «The improvement of the linguistic communicative competence for the civil servants (72 hours)» on the basis of the RANEPA (Voronezh branch), contributing to the development of the linguistic competence of the civil servants of the Russian Federation, Voronezh region. Scope of application. State Service of the Russian Federation. Conclusions. The development of the advanced training course «The improvement of the linguistic communicative competence for the civil servants (72 hours)»on the basis of the RANEPA (Voronezh branch). This proposal will contribute to the development of the linguistic and communicative competence in the public sector.
